WWAV Hedge Fund Activity: Q1 2016 in Review

445 of the 3,753 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in The WhiteWave Foods Company (WWAV) for Q1 2016, worth a combined $6.07B — up 7.9% from $5.63B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 67 funds opened new WWAV positions and 47 closed out — a net gain of 20 holders — while 177 added to existing stakes and 147 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Bank of America, adding an estimated $64.3M. The largest seller was Miura Global Management, cutting an estimated $47.5M.
